Asphalt Works Commence at Kaymaklı Martyrs' Monument

The municipality of Lefkoşa Türk has announced that it will commence asphalt and infrastructure works around the Kaymaklı Martyrs' Monument. The work is set to begin on Sunday, and during this period, traffic flow in the area will be managed in a controlled manner.
Such infrastructure projects are crucial for urban development and road safety, as they aim to provide a safer and more organized transportation option for both residents and visitors in Kaymaklı, one of the significant neighborhoods of Lefkoşa.
Authorities are urging drivers to remain cautious during the ongoing works and to adhere to traffic guidance signs. It is recommended that those using this route consider alternative paths.
